## Day 2: Day Trip to Tagaytay

Morning:

  • Travel to Tagaytay: After breakfast, take a scenic drive to Tagaytay (about 1.5-2 hours from Manila). The cool climate and beautiful views of Taal Volcano are a refreshing escape.

Midday:

  • Lunch with a View: Stop at Balay Dako for a delicious lunch with a view of Taal Lake. Their kare-kare (oxtail stew) is a must-try!

Afternoon:

  • Explore Taal Volcano: If you’re feeling adventurous, take a boat ride to Taal Volcano and hike to the crater. The views are absolutely breathtaking! If hiking isn’t your thing, you can enjoy the scenery from the viewing deck.

Evening:

  • Dinner in Tagaytay: Head back to Tagaytay and enjoy dinner at Josephine Restaurant, known for its Filipino dishes and stunning views. After dinner, you can grab some buko pie (coconut pie) for dessert!

Tips:

  • Transportation: Consider hiring a private car or using ride-sharing apps for convenience.
  • Local Delicacies: Don’t miss out on trying local snacks like lechon (roast pig) and halo-halo (a popular dessert).
  • Stay Hydrated: The weather can be warm, so keep hydrated and wear sunscreen!
